Role Description The Manager Account role is a full-time, on-site position based in Noida. This role is responsible for overseeing client accounts, managing day-to-day financial operations, and ensuring accurate and timely handling of accounting records. Typical responsibilities include supervising bookkeeping activities, reviewing reconciliations and financial statements, monitoring accounts payable and receivable, and supporting budgeting and forecasting processes. The Manager Account will collaborate with internal teams and clients to resolve accounting issues, maintain compliance with relevant laws and standards, and prepare periodic reports for management review. The role also involves streamlining accounting workflows, implementing best practices, and contributing to process improvement initiatives.
Qualifications
Strong knowledge of accounting principles, standards, and financial reporting practices.
Experience managing ledgers, reconciliations, accounts payable/receivable, and month-end closing activities.
Proficiency in accounting software and spreadsheets; ability to analyze financial data and generate clear reports.
Excellent organizational and time-management skills, with attention to detail and accuracy.
Effective communication and stakeholder management abilities for working with clients and internal teams.
Proven experience in a supervisory or managerial accounting role, preferably within a consultancy or professional services environment.
Relevant academic background such as a degree in Accounting, Finance, Commerce, or a related field; professional certifications (e.g., CA, CMA, CPA) are an advantage.
Commitment to ethical practices, confidentiality, and compliance with applicable financial regulations and company policies.
